  • Baking soda raises the pH of the meat’s surface, helping to break down tough muscle fibers. This keeps the meat juicy and prevents it from tightening too much during cooking.
  • Lime juice adds a gentle acidity, which further breaks down the protein fibers while also adding a fresh, zesty flavor.

  • Filet mignon – Incredibly tender with a buttery texture, perfect for babies and young toddlers.
  • Ribeye – Well-marbled and rich in flavor, stays juicy and soft after cooking.
